Germline B cell receptors specific for HIV-1 Envelope CD4 binding site epitopes (VRC01-class glBCRs)

Overview

Germline B cell receptors (BCRs) specific for the HIV-1 Envelope (Env) CD4 binding site (CD4bs) are the naive, unmutated precursors of broadly neutralizing antibodies (bnAbs) such as VRC01 [1, 2]. These receptors are the primary targets of germline-targeting vaccine strategies, which aim to initiate the development of bnAbs in HIV-uninfected individuals [1, 3]. Because native HIV-1 Env has negligible affinity for these germline precursors, engineered immunogens like the eOD-GT8 60mer nanoparticle are designed to specifically bind and activate B cells expressing these receptors [2, 4]. Once activated, these B cells undergo somatic hypermutation and affinity maturation in germinal centers, a process that must be further guided by sequential booster immunogens to eventually produce mature, broad-spectrum neutralizing antibodies [1, 5]. This approach represents a paradigm shift in vaccinology, moving from traditional whole-antigen exposure to the precise manipulation of specific B cell lineages to overcome the extreme diversity of HIV-1 [3, 5]. Successful priming of these receptors has been demonstrated in human clinical trials (e.g., IAVI G001), marking a significant milestone in HIV vaccine development [1].

Mechanism of action

Germline-targeting immunogens bind to and activate rare naive B cells expressing specific germline BCRs, initiating somatic hypermutation and affinity maturation toward broadly neutralizing antibodies [1, 2].
